0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

机智云配网教程第一期:GAgent固件烧录与调试指南

机智云 2025-06-27 19:06 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群


前言

本文主要总结了我在使用机智云的过程中积累的经验,特别是针对初学者,旨在帮助大家少走弯路。


注:配网过程的详细教程可以参考B站“辰哥单片机机智云配网”视频,同时该视频下附有大量的资料,本文所使用的工具软件基本都在其中提供。



GAgent概述b6a30b64-5346-11f0-986f-92fbcf53809c.png


GAgent是机智云提供的设备端固件,充当设备的“通信管家”。它的主要功能包括:

1.实现设备与机智云云端的双向通信。

2.负责WiFi/BLE模块的协议转换。

3.支持本地局域网控制。

4.提供安全认证和OTA(Over-the-Air)固件升级功能。



硬件准备b6a30b64-5346-11f0-986f-92fbcf53809c.png


1、ESP-01s模块

这款模块体积小巧,适合用于便携式开发。它是

esp8266芯片的变种,适合于WiFi连接。





b6c547ec-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

2、ESP-01s固件烧录工具


该工具用于将固件烧录到ESP8266模块。通常,ESP-01s模块和烧录器会捆绑出售,建议购买该工具,因为它比传统的USB转TTL模块更简单易用,特别适合新手。





b6dac432-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png



软件准备b6a30b64-5346-11f0-986f-92fbcf53809c.png


1、CH340驱动

用于识别烧录器,确保烧录过程中的通信正常。





b87ea006-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png



GAgent固件包b6a30b64-5346-11f0-986f-92fbcf53809c.png


从机智云官网下载适用于ESP8266的GAgent固件包。

下载链接:机智云GAgent固件





b89bb4fc-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png


2、FLASH烧写工具


用于给WiFi模块烧录固件程序。

下载链接:乐鑫FLASH烧录工具


3、机智云串口助手


这款工具内置AT指令,方便配置网络和相关协议,也能够查看数据点,便于调试开发。

下载链接:机智云串口助手

提供Windows和mac OS版本。





b8b2da10-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png
机智云产品调试APPb6a30b64-5346-11f0-986f-92fbcf53809c.png


用于连接并配置网络,方便调试开发。

下载链接:机智云产品调试APP





b8cfd9e4-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png



固件烧录b6a30b64-5346-11f0-986f-92fbcf53809c.png

1、安装CH340驱动

进入官网,下载并安装CH341SER.EXE驱动程序。





b8f63760-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

2、连接ESP-01s到烧录器

将ESP-01s模块插入烧录器,并通过USB接口连接到电脑





b914b2c6-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png


b934ec30-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png


b94fd400-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png
烧录固件b6a30b64-5346-11f0-986f-92fbcf53809c.png


打开烧录工具,选择对应的GAgent固件文件,点击“烧录”按钮,等待烧录完成。



测试与调试b6a30b64-5346-11f0-986f-92fbcf53809c.png

1、注册机智云开发者账号

首先需要注册一个机智云开发者账号,创建新的开发者项目。





b97f91fe-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

2、创建测试产品


在机智云平台上创建一个测试产品,并随便创建一个数据点(例如:开关)。在设置时,选择数据类型为布尔值(开关类型),并定义产品的PK和PS(在页面左上角显示)。





b9b93a8a-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

3、配置串口助手


打开机智云串口调试助手,点击“新增”配置,将产品的PK和PS码复制进去。然后在产品列表中勾选刚才创建的产品,点击“模拟MCU”开始模拟。





b9cded7c-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

4、进行测试


完成以上步骤后,进行功能测试,确保固件烧录与网络配置正确。





b9e8d9de-5346-11f0-986f-92fbcf53809c.pngb6a30b64-5346-11f0-986f-92fbcf53809c.png

至此,GAgent固件烧录与配置完成。


注:

若使用CH340 USB转TTL进行烧录,可能需要手动配置引脚连接。相关资料可以参考本篇文章的详细说明。


通过以上步骤,你应该能够成功烧录机智云的GAgent固件,并进行相关的设备调试。


声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 调试
    +关注

    关注

    7

    文章

    623

    浏览量

    35383
  • 固件
    +关注

    关注

    11

    文章

    568

    浏览量

    24610
  • 机智云
    +关注

    关注

    3

    文章

    629

    浏览量

    27633
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    ESP8266固件升级,SoftAp 模式下,支持全球升级

    GAgent 乐鑫 04020029 版本已经发布到机智下载中心changelog:1.增加SoftAp 模式下,支持全球化;2.优化
    发表于 04-28 14:34

    福利:《BLDC驱动板如何合理布局第一期》直播

    BLDC驱动板如何合理布局(第一期)[ckplayer]http://media.elecfans.com/topic/gongkaike/2019/06/0e17e22964159596f26537bfa6b03736/30/hls/index.m3u8[/ckplayer]第二
    发表于 07-02 18:21

    请问第一期视频需要掌握什么程度?

    第一期视频刚看到NAND FLASH控制器,感觉里面好多代码都好难懂,看第一期视频需要掌握到什么程度?能看懂就好嘛?老师也就是对照着代码在讲,不需要会写吧?
    发表于 07-23 05:45

    请问你们第一期视频都是怎么学的?

    想问各位学完第一期或正在学习第一期的大佬: 你们第一期视频都是怎么学的呢?里面的代码都是自己码遍么?码的话按什么思路比较好,按韦老师上课讲的思路凭记忆写么 ?感觉里面有些课时的代码还
    发表于 09-24 05:45

    机智产品开发入门到精通二:GAgent,串口调试助手,常用芯片烧录固件方法,及网关类产品调试

    控制,wifi模组般采用过后形成局域,通过局域发现设备的形式绑定,机智
    发表于 05-07 14:56

    【视频教程】单片机新手教程(第一期)单片机介绍

    大家下午好!今天邀请了张角老师,来为大家深入讲解单片机,视频为个系列,本次为第一期内容,请持续关注,我会进行更新!
    发表于 03-26 15:45

    ESP8266-01S接入机智物联网平台

    配置网络机智网站下载串口调试助手下载完毕后双击exe文件进入应用按照顺序操作上面的key与secret是在机智
    发表于 04-06 18:32

    ESP8266-01烧录机智GAgent时SPI Mode选择哪种?

    ESP8266-01烧录机智GAgent时SPI Mode选择哪种?是选择合并的固件还是单独烧写
    发表于 11-10 07:54

    电子报2011年第一期

    电子发烧友向大家提供了电子报2011年的第一期报刊,希望对大家学习有用,感谢大家对电子发烧友的支持 本内容绝对完整
    发表于 03-14 18:17 0次下载
    电子报2011年<b class='flag-5'>第一期</b>

    动手玩转Arduino(第一期)

    动手玩转Arduino(第一期),有需要的下来看看
    发表于 07-08 14:23 8次下载

    通过正点原子ATK-ESP8266 WiFi模块刷机智Gagent固件

    通过在正点原子ATK-ESP8266 WiFi模块 刷机智Gagent固件,可以快速构建串口-WIFI 数据传输方案,方便设备使用互联网传输数据。
    的头像 发表于 08-12 14:19 8564次阅读

    课回放 I RK3588 实例课程第一期:项目总结和技术答疑

    课回放 I RK3588 实例课程第一期:项目总结和技术答疑
    的头像 发表于 07-31 17:10 1901次阅读
    <b class='flag-5'>网</b>课回放 I RK3588 实例课程<b class='flag-5'>第一期</b>:项目总结和技术答疑

    机智入门必备》手把手教你烧录GAgent固件

    本文《机智入门必备》将详细讲解GAgent固件烧录过程,从基础设置到实际操作,将步步带你完
    的头像 发表于 09-12 08:04 1225次阅读
    《<b class='flag-5'>机智</b><b class='flag-5'>云</b>入门必备》手把手教你<b class='flag-5'>烧录</b><b class='flag-5'>GAgent</b><b class='flag-5'>固件</b>

    ESP8266烧录机智教程

    ESP8266模块因其低成本和高性能,广泛应用于智能家居和工业自动化等领域。机智平台提供了功能,简化了设备的联网过程。本教程将详细
    的头像 发表于 05-24 11:04 1559次阅读
    ESP8266<b class='flag-5'>烧录</b>与<b class='flag-5'>机智</b><b class='flag-5'>云</b><b class='flag-5'>一</b>键<b class='flag-5'>配</b><b class='flag-5'>网</b>教程

    机智教程 第二:生成MCU代码包与调试

    在上一期中,我们介绍了机智GAgent固件烧录过程,并在测试中完成了
    的头像 发表于 06-28 10:02 605次阅读
    <b class='flag-5'>机智</b><b class='flag-5'>云</b><b class='flag-5'>配</b><b class='flag-5'>网</b>教程 第二<b class='flag-5'>期</b>:生成MCU代码包与<b class='flag-5'>调试</b>